Renovation framing services involve the installation, modification, or reinforcement of the structural framework within a building. This work typically includes adding or removing walls, supporting beams, or other structural elements to accommodate changes in the layout or design of a property. Skilled contractors assess the existing structure, ensuring modifications meet safety standards and building codes, while providing a solid foundation for subsequent renovation work. Proper framing is essential for creating a stable, functional space that can support new features or layouts.

These services are often sought to resolve common structural problems that arise during remodeling projects. For example, homeowners may need to remove a wall to open up a living area or create an open-concept kitchen. In other cases, existing framing may be compromised due to age, damage, or previous poor construction, requiring reinforcement or replacement. Renovation framing helps to address these issues by restoring or improving the structural integrity of a property, ensuring safety and longevity of the renovated space.

Properties that typically utilize renovation framing services include older homes undergoing updates, commercial buildings being repurposed, or residential additions such as second-story expansions or sunrooms. It is also common in projects where walls are being moved or removed to create more open, functional layouts. The overview below groups typical Renovation Framing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or framing repairs or adjustments us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Moderate Renovations - Larger framing projects, such as room additions or extensive modifications, often cost between $1,200-$3,500. These are common for mid-sized renovations handled by local contractors.

Full Replacement - Replacing entire framing structures can range from $4,000-$8,000 or more, depending on the scope and complexity of the project. Larger, more involved jobs tend to push into the higher price tiers.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or complex framing work, including specialty designs or structural reinforcements,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less frequent but handled by experienced service providers for large-scale renovations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is renovation framing? Renovation framing involves constructing or modifying the structural framework of a building during a renovation project to ensure stability and support for new or existing elements.

How do local contractors handle renovation framing projects? Local service providers assess the existing structure, plan the necessary modifications, and execute framing work to meet the specific requirements of each renovation.

What materials are commonly used in renovation framing? Common materials include wood and metal studs, which are chosen based on the project's scope, building codes, and structural needs.

Why is proper framing important in renovations? Proper framing ensures the stability of walls, ceilings, and floors, and provides a solid foundation for subsequent construction or finishing work.
